自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

冯立彬的博客

关注性能、效率、大型网站架构、分布式应用、大数据计算等

  • 博客(13)
  • 资源 (18)
  • 收藏
  • 关注

原创 根据自定类型,采用JAVASCRIPT方便进行数据完整性验证,所有页面都可以通用

页面输入完整性是编写BS经常遇到的问题,如果那里需要就到那里写,那可是要花不少的时候,并且造成不必要的浪费,下面是一个通过校验脚本,使用非常方便,通过传入FORM名就可以进行校验,通过在页面控件中增加用户本身自定义属性,进行方便的验证,包括数字的输入、密码的输入、EMAIL的输入,用户本身可以进行无限的扩展,使用如下,在页面中加入如下代码:form name="form1">

2008-07-31 23:44:00 7358

原创 对一个可进行带括号、加减乘除运算类的分析

源程序来源于:http://bbs.tarena.com.cn/viewthread.php?tid=102826&extra=&page=1这里主要对该程序的运行进行基本的分析,搞清楚其原理。因为我本人原来在参加面试的时候遇到过这样的问题,当时就没有答上来,有点后悔,所有这里补补。这个程序主要采用的是将数进行压栈的方式,我们知道栈的方式是先进后出,一直遇到当前阶段优先级最高的才做运算,如

2008-07-31 14:50:00 9231

原创 JAVA内部类示例分析

内部类是非常有用的类,如果该内部类只为当前类服务,写成内部类将是非常好的选择,详细看程序中的注释:import java.util.HashMap;public class Test1 { //声明一个存储"指令"的HashMap,根据"指令"存取不同的值 private static HashMap hashMap=new HashMap(); //声明一个静态内部类,并在内部类声明

2008-07-31 13:27:00 8291

原创 接口和抽象类有什么区别

接口和抽象类有什么区别 你选择使用接口和抽象类的依据是什么? 接口和抽象类的概念不一样。接口是对动作的抽象,抽象类是对根源的抽象。抽象类表示的是,这个对象是什么。接口表示的是,这个对象能做什么。比如,男人,女人,这两个类(如果是类的话……),他们的抽象类是人。说明,他们都是人。人可以吃东西,狗也可以吃东西,你可以把“吃东西”定义成一个接口,然后让这些类去实现它.所以,在高级

2008-07-31 12:54:00 277192 100

原创 金额与数字转化常用实用几个JS方法

财务系统中常用到金额与数字转化的处理,这里包括以下几个方法:1、去空格2、页面控件的金额与数字之间的转换3、一般金额与数字之间的转换4、将数字金额转化为汉字金额。//在引用页面,可以采用document.forms[0].field1.value.trim()引用去空格String.prototype.trim = function(){ return this.replace(/(

2008-07-29 13:12:00 14919 1

原创 Sybase中使用JAVA函数

在SYBASE12.5或者更久以前的版本都是不支持函数,但是有些时候我们又需要一些函数,而不仅仅是过程,这里有可以采用JAVA实现,并且写JAVA肯定比写存储过程要好多了,JAVA处理数据的能力或者是类型,会让SYBASE增不少光彩。以下是网上找到的一篇文章,详细介绍如何在SYBASE中使用JAVA,但我先说明一点,我现在用的是12.5.4这个版本,也提示开启JAVA功能成功,但是去不能够将JAR

2008-07-29 12:28:00 7336 1

原创 采用审计数据库监视数据库的更改

有些时候我们需要知道数据表做了什么样的更改,写入了什么样的语句,这个时候可以采用审计数据库来做这个工作,用以记录需要的信息,但是配置过程有点烦,下面是一篇CHINAUNIX上面的文章,说如何配置审计数据库:http://bbs.chinaunix.net/archiver/?tid-560903.html本文出自:冯立彬的博客

2008-07-26 19:58:00 5645

原创 SYBASE中生成所有建表语句的过程

--经常在用,感觉还不错。在数据移植的时候,配上BCP,那可是非常的方便if exists(select 1 from sysobjects where name = 'sp_gent' and type = 'P') drop procedure sp_gentgocreate procedure sp_gent @tblname varchar(30) = null, @pr

2008-07-24 20:13:00 12763 4

原创 Sybase中字符串替换函数:STR_REPLACE

用法:SELECT STR_REPLACE("abc99922defg121212hicde","a","") 不过,好像不支持正则表达式,如下则得不到想要的结果:去掉所有非数字字符:SELECT STR_REPLACE("abc99922defg121212hicde","[^0-9]","")不过,有也不错了,前面一直找,还以为没有。本文出自:冯立彬的博客

2008-07-24 19:47:00 19440 2

原创 在JS中使用trim()方法

在调用trim()的JS方法上面加入如下JS代码:String.prototype.trim = function(){    return this.replace(/(^/s*)|(/s*$)/g, "");}就可以像JAVA中使用trim()方法了:if(document.forms[0].aa.value.trim()==""){ }本文出自:冯立彬的博

2008-07-24 19:22:00 9124

原创 不同数据库移植移植方法一、二

当我们把有些应用写到存储过程中,或者是调用与系统相关的函数,此时想把当前系统移值到其它的数据库上,这个往往是非常头痛的问题,因为不同的系统支持不同的存储过程,如ORACLE和SYBASE。1、采用中间对照表。将SYBASE中常用的函数与ORACLE中相对的函数相对应,如果有的那是肯定非常好,都不用更改了,如果两个要实现相同功能的函数名称却不相同的时候,如SYBASE中的ISNULL函数,而OR

2008-07-22 13:00:00 6977

转载 java与c/c++进行socket通信的一些问题

 文章来源:http://blog.csdn.net/kingfish/archive/2005/03/29/333635.aspx 近几天看到csdn上问c/c++和java通信的问题比较多,特别是c特有的数据结构(如struct)。特地根据网友的一个问题举个例子,希望对初学者有所帮助。原问题见:http://community.csdn.net/Expert/topic/3886/

2008-07-21 15:58:00 9173

原创 Sybase Workspace 中文显示设置

数据库SYBASE连接的时候,选择JDBC连接,然后在字符串后加字符集为CP936,如下示: jdbc:sybase:Tds:FENGLB:5000/IMPS?charset=cp936这样就可以正常显示中文,如用CP850就不行。本文出自:冯立彬的博客

2008-07-01 14:11:00 6801 1

hadoop_job_execute_conf.xml

hadoop1.2.1执行完计算后,从hdfs中找出来的配置文件,可以帮助指导学习其配置

2014-06-15

Hadoop环境搭建、配置及通过执行计算来验证的示例

Hadoop从存储上来说,是类似于冗余磁盘阵列(RAID)的存储方式,将数据分散存储并提供以提供吞吐量,它的存储系统就是HDFS(HadoopDistuibute Fils System);从计算上来说,它通过MapReduce模型,将大数据的计算分发到多台计算机上完成,再将结果合并,减少计算的时间。 Hadoop适合于: 1、超大数据的计算; 2、一次写入、多次读取的模式; 3、可以跑在普通的硬件上。 Hadoop不适合: 1、低延迟的数据访问,它是为高数据吞吐量应用优化的; 2、大量的小文件 hadoop客户端需要和namenode进行交互,而namenode中存放的是datanode的文件属性,且都是在内存中,如果小文件过多,namenode是存放不了的; 3、多用户写入,任意修改文件。 Hadoop适合于一次计算,多次读取的场景,如搜索引擎,只支持随机读取不支持随机写入,如Hadoop和Lucene的集成就不能够直接集成,因为Lucene支持随机写入。 本文将从使用的角度上谈了如何搭建Hadoop、如何配置Hadoop、如何验证Hadoop及在Hadoop上面执行计算,以及可能会遇到些什么样的问题。

2013-12-26

流程图绘制软件 Dia for Windows 0.97.2

它功能强大和跨平台特性,也源于它原生支持简体中文界面。与Visio相比,Dia安装包仅不足20MB,可以放在网盘或U盘中随身携带。初用者可能觉得Dia用法比较繁琐而麻烦,但是无法否认,它仍然是综合性能最佳的免费替代方案。   Dia支持导出的流程图格式如下:EPS、SVG、DXF(Autocad格式)、CGM、WMF、PNG、JPEG、VDX(Microsoft Visio格式)。

2013-08-24

SPI的简单示例

SPI的简单示例,SPI的简单示例,SPI的简单示例

2011-12-19

处理后的ibator1.2.1

去除了注释、去除Example方法及去除生成的id前面的“ibatorgenerated_”

2011-10-05

简单的JAVA HTML服务器

简单的JAVA HTML服务器 实现原理为采用Socket原理、线程池、输入输出流及简单的HTTP协议,麻烦虽小,五脏俱全,只有两个类文件。 使用方法,在DOS窗口下,转到当前HTMLJAR所在目录,打入如下命令: java -Djava.ext.dirs=. httpserver.HttpServer [HTML服务所在路径] [端口] HTML服务所在路径及端口参数是可选的,路径默认路径为当前应用所在路径,默认端口为1234,首页文件可为index.html或 index.html 启动好后,找一个html文件放在当前目录下,重命名为index.html,打开浏览器,输入:http://localhost:1234,即可以返回该页面. JAR编译的JDK版本1.6,至少要JDK1.5以上,因为其中用到JDK自带的线程池,内附源码,用户可以自已将源码再打包。 下载路径为:

2009-10-19

在SYBASE中用于生当前数据库中所有表的建表语句的过程

在SYBASE中用于生当前数据库中所有表的建表语句的过程。在系统备份的加上BCP,那是相当的好。

2008-07-24

Struts配置数据源及分页的JAR

Struts配置数据源及分页的JAR,有些时候你需要的时候不一定找得到,放在这里,共享

2007-09-27

基于Struts的留言本

基于Struts的留言本,实现了国际化、分布显示、录入、显示、删除等等功能,麻Q虽小,该有的都有了。完全是遵守于STRUTS标准来的

2007-09-27

DWR(Direct Web Remote)中文文档

DWR(Direct Web Remote)中文文档,DWR是可以很方便的通过JS操作JAVA的开源软件

2007-09-07

快乐表格-将数据很轻松的显示在网页表格中

将任意表中的数据以TABLE的形式显示出来,并具有动态生成查询、动态排序功能.rar

2007-09-03

将SQL的查询结果以表格形式返回,并生成翻页等

可以将SQL的查询结果,以表格的形式返回,任何表格,任何SQL语句都可以实现显示,方便开发,因为这样可以减少我们每次都去从数据库里读数据的时候,需要再次重新写代码的过程了。

2007-08-31

downFile.jar的源程序

downFile.jar的源程序

2007-08-16

downFile.jar

多线程、断点续传jar

2007-08-16

非常好Ajax基础教程

原理讲得很清楚,不过就是英文版,看了这书你想不入门都不行,共有48页,WORD版,认真看前面20页,后面的略看,把重点看看就OK。

2007-07-22

downFile多线程断点续传下载源程序

多线程断点续传下载源程序源程序

2007-07-10

downFile多线程断点续传下载JAR

多线程断点续传下载JAR,可以同时进行很多个文件下载,去我的BLOG可以看对应的示例

2007-07-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除